Why Aluminum?
Aluminum has long been a material of choice for various applications due to its exceptional properties. When it comes to air piping systems, aluminum offers several advantages:
Lightweight: Aluminum pipes are significantly lighter than traditional materials like steel or copper, making them easier to handle and install. This characteristic also reduces the load on supporting structures, simplifying installation and lowering costs.
Corrosion Resistance: Unlike steel, aluminum doesn't rust, making it ideal for environments where moisture or corrosive substances are present. This corrosion resistance translates to longevity, ensuring reliable performance over the long term.
Smooth Interior Surface: Aluminum pipes boast a smooth interior surface that minimizes air friction and pressure drop. This design feature promotes efficient airflow, resulting in energy savings and enhanced system performance.
Modular Design: Aluminum air pipe systems often feature a modular design with easy-to-connect components. This modularity allows for flexible layout configurations, adaptability to changing needs, and straightforward expansions or modifications.
The Role of Connectors
While the pipes themselves form the backbone of the air distribution network, connectors are the glue that holds everything together – quite literally. These small but critical components play several essential roles in aluminum air pipe systems:
Sealing: Connectors ensure airtight seals between pipe sections, preventing leaks and maintaining system efficiency. Proper sealing is crucial for optimizing airflow and minimizing energy losses.
Flexibility: Aluminum Pipe Connectors come in various shapes and configurations, enabling the creation of complex layouts to suit specific space constraints or operational requirements. Whether it's elbows, tees, crosses, or reducers, connectors allow for seamless transitions between different pipe segments.
Accessibility: In maintenance and repair scenarios, connectors facilitate easy access to individual pipe sections without requiring extensive disassembly. This accessibility reduces downtime during servicing, keeping operations running smoothly.
Durability: High-quality aluminum connectors are designed to withstand the rigors of industrial environments, ensuring long-lasting performance and reliability. From temperature fluctuations to mechanical stress, these connectors maintain their integrity under demanding conditions.
Choosing the Right Connectors
Selecting the appropriate connectors for an aluminum air pipe system is crucial for optimizing performance and efficiency. Here are some factors to consider:
Compatibility: Ensure that connectors are compatible with the specific type and size of aluminum pipes being used. Proper matching prevents issues such as leaks or pressure drops.
Quality: Invest in connectors made from high-grade materials and precision engineering. Quality connectors offer superior sealing properties, durability, and resistance to wear and tear.
Design: Evaluate the design features of connectors, such as sealing mechanisms, connection methods, and ease of installation. Choose connectors that facilitate quick and secure assembly while minimizing potential points of failure.
Application: Consider the operational requirements and environmental conditions of the air piping system. Select connectors rated for the appropriate pressure, temperature, and chemical exposure to ensure reliable performance in the intended application.
